The Torch is Coming to Markham

image Markham is a Celebration Community for the 2010 Olympic Torch Relay image

Markham Celebration Events

Join us to welcome the Olympic Flame as it stops in Markham on its way to Vancouver. Markham is a proud Celebration Community and we're throwing a party. Be a part of history and enjoy the festivities.

Celebration Parade - 9:30 a.m. to 10 a.m.
Markham Athletes and community groups march into the Markham Civic Centre to help begin the official ceremonies and entertainment. View Parade Route

Official Ceremonies & Entertainment - 10 a.m. to 12:30 p.m.
Official ceremonies with greetings from the federal, provincial representatives, and Mayor Scarpitti plus entertainment. The stage show includes the Markham Community Dance Troupe, Justin Hines, Suzie Mc Neil, The Leahy Family and Torch Relay sponsors.

Featured Performer - 12:30 p.m. to 1 p.m.
Suzie McNeil takes the stage and continues the celebration


Main Stage Entertainment & Festivities take place at:

Markham Civic Centre
101 Town Centre Blvd.
Markham, Ontario L3R 9W3
(northwest corner of Hwy. 7 and Warden Ave.)

For those with accessibility or accommodation requirements, attendant care will be provided.

Please Note: There will be no parking at the Markham Civic Centre. Consider taking VIVA or York Region Transit instead. Find route and schedule information at www.yorkregiontransit.com external link opens new window.
